- Kurze Einführung zum Thema Testen des ICOtronic Systems
- Testen damit wir sehen, dass Hardware wie erwartet funktioniert
- Testen in Verbindung mit Firmware (kein reiner Test der Hardware)
- ICOtest: Python-Paket zum Testen mittels pytest
- Für die auf der Folie zu sehende ICOtronic Hardware
- STU:
- „Basisstation“ mittels CAN mit Computer verbunden
- Sensor Nodes: Sensorische Hardware mittels Bluetooth mit STU verbunden
- Dokumentation auf „Read the Docs“-Website
Benötigte Hard- und Software
# Verwendung
- `icotest run` (Wrapper für pytest)
- option `-k` um bestimmte Tests auszuwählen
- Konfiguration mittels YAML-File
# Aktueller Stand
- Grundgerüst steht: Für Hardware auf meinem Tisch funktioniert es
- Zusätzliche Tests und Parameteranpassung fehlt noch:
- Braucht Hardware-Experte
- Test-Prozedur sollte noch beschrieben werden